Authentication](#-identity--authentication)\n- [Contributing](#-contributing)\n\n---\n\n## 🛡️ Agent Firewalls \u0026 Gateways (Runtime Protection)\n*Tools that sit between the agent and the world to filter traffic, prevent unauthorized tool access, and block prompt injections.*\n\n- **[AgentGateway](https://github.com/agentgateway/agentgateway)** - A Linux Foundation project providing an AI-native proxy for secure connectivity (A2A \u0026 MCP protocols). It adds RBAC, observability, and policy enforcement to agent-tool interactions.\n- **[Envoy AI Gateway](https://gateway.envoyproxy.io/)** - An Envoy-based gateway that manages request traffic to GenAI services, providing a control point for rate limiting and policy enforcement.\n\n## ⚔️ Red Teaming \u0026 Vulnerability Scanners\n*Offensive tools to test agents for security flaws, loop conditions, and unauthorized actions.*\n\n- **[Strix](https://github.com/usestrix/strix)** - An autonomous AI agent designed for penetration testing. It runs inside a docker sandbox to actively probe applications and generate verified exploit capabilities.\n- **[PyRIT](https://github.com/Azure/PyRIT)** - Microsoft’s open-source red teaming framework for generative AI. It automates multi-turn adversarial attacks to test if an agent can be coerced into harmful behavior.\n- **[Agentic Security](https://github.com/msoedov/agentic_security)** - A dedicated vulnerability scanner for agent workflows and LLMs capable of running multi-step jailbreaks and fuzzing attacks against agent logic.\n- **[Garak](https://github.com/leondz/garak)** - The \"Nmap for LLMs.\" A vulnerability scanner that probes models for hallucination, data leakage, and prompt injection susceptibilities.\n- **[A2A Scanner](https://github.com/cisco-ai-defense/a2a-scanner)** - A scanner by Cisco designed to inspect \"Agent-to-Agent\" communication protocols for threats, validating agent identities and ensuring compliance with communication specs.\n- **[Cybersecurity AI (CAI)](https://github.com/aliasrobotics/cai)** - A framework for building specialized security agents for offensive and defensive operations, often used in CTF (Capture The Flag) scenarios.\n\n## 🔍 Static Analysis \u0026 Linters\n*Tools to analyze agent configuration and logic code before deployment.*\n\n- **[Agentic Radar](https://github.com/splx-ai/agentic-radar)** - A static analysis tool that visualizes agent workflows (LangGraph, CrewAI, AutoGen). It detects risky tool usage, permission loops, and maps them to known vulnerabilities.\n- **[Agent Bound](https://github.com/ElPaisano/agent-bound)** - A design-time analysis tool that calculates \"Agentic Entropy\"—a metric to quantify the unpredictability and risk of infinite loops or unconstrained actions in agent architectures.\n- **[Checkov](https://github.com/bridgecrewio/checkov)** - While primarily for IaC, Checkov includes policies for scanning AI infrastructure and configurations to prevent misconfigurations in deployment.\n\n## 📦 Sandboxing \u0026 Isolation Environments\n*Secure runtimes to prevent agents from damaging the host system during code execution.*\n\n- **[SandboxAI](https://github.com/substratusai/sandboxai)** - An open-source runtime for executing AI-generated code (Python/Shell) in isolated containers with granular permission controls.\n- **[Kubernetes Agent Sandbox](https://github.com/kubernetes-sigs/agent-sandbox)** - A Kubernetes Native project providing a Sandbox Custom Resource Definition (CRD) to manage isolated, stateful workloads for AI agents.\n- **[Agent-Infra Sandbox](https://github.com/agent-infra/sandbox)** - An \"All-In-One\" sandbox combining Browser, Shell, VSCode, and File System access in a single Docker container, optimized for agentic tasks.\n- **[OpenHands](https://github.com/All-Hands-AI/OpenHands)** - Formerly OpenDevin, this platform includes a secure runtime environment for autonomous coding agents to operate without accessing the host machine's sensitive files.\n\n## 🚧 Guardrails \u0026 Compliance\n*Middleware to enforce business logic and safety policies on inputs and outputs.*\n\n- **[NeMo Guardrails](https://github.com/NVIDIA/NeMo-Guardrails)** - NVIDIA’s toolkit for adding programmable rails to LLM-based apps. It ensures agents stay on topic, avoid jailbreaks, and adhere to defined safety policies.\n- **[Guardrails](https://github.com/guardrails-ai/guardrails)** - A Python framework for validating LLM outputs against structural and semantic rules (e.g., \"must return valid JSON,\" \"must not contain PII\").\n- **[LiteLLM Guardrails](https://github.com/BerriAI/litellm)** - While known for model proxying, LiteLLM includes built-in guardrail features to filter requests and responses across multiple LLM providers.\n\n## 📊 Benchmarks \u0026 Datasets\n*Resources to evaluate agent security performance.*\n\n- **[CVE Bench](https://github.com/uiuc-kang-lab/cve-bench)** - A benchmark for evaluating an AI agent's ability to exploit real-world web application vulnerabilities (useful for testing defensive agents).\n\n## 🆔 Identity \u0026 Authentication\n*Tools to manage agent identity (non-human identities).*\n\n- **[WSO2](https://github.com/wso2)** - An identity management solution that treats AI agents as first-class identities, enabling secure authentication and authorization for agent actions.\n\n---\n\n## 🤝 Contributing\n\nContributions are welcome!
